Appliquer la notion

Les fichiers public.pem et private.pem contiennent respectivement des clés publique et privée RSA.

Enregistrer le fichier public.pem.

Question

Le fichier msg.enc ci-dessous a été chiffré avec la clé privée. Le mot de passe qui protège la clé privée est test (ne refaites pas ça chez vous !)

Enregistrer le fichier msg.enc.

Trouver le contenu du message.

Indice

On utilisera une commande de la forme :

1
openssl rsautl -decrypt -inkey cle_privée -in message_chiffré.enc -out message_en_clair.txt 

Indice

On peut utiliser cat pour afficher le contenu d'un fichier.

Solution

On peut utiliser la commande suivante pour déchiffrer.

1
openssl rsautl -decrypt -inkey private.pem -in msg.enc -out message_en_clair.txt 

Puis avec cat pour voir le contenu du message :

1
cat message_en_clair.txt

Qui est :

1
Bravo H4ck3rm4n